Waterless Car Wash
Report Abuse

Waterless Car Wash

Website Details

Aquanought – Waterless Car Wash Offers Mobile Services, Waterless Car Wash Products and Eco-Friendly Car Wash Franchise Packages – Based in Chepstow – UK.